In a traditional hospital, a "simple" patient visit often involves a mountain of paperwork, long wait times, and fragmented data. With InfyHMS v1.4.7, that story changes:

The Seamless Entry: A patient arrives and their history is pulled up instantly. v1.4.7 features a refined Patient Management module where demographics, blood group, and insurance details are all visible on one screen. No more digging through filing cabinets.

The Doctor’s Dashboard: Dr. Sarah logs in to find her entire day mapped out. The Appointment Module prevents double-booking, while the IPD/OPD (In-Patient/Out-Patient) systems allow her to track a patient’s journey from a routine check-up to a specialized ward without losing a single note.

Precision in the Pharmacy: When Dr. Sarah prescribes medication, the order hits the Pharmacy Management system in real-time. v1.4.7 tracks stock levels automatically, flagging if a life-saving drug is running low so the "story" doesn't end with an "out of stock" notice. Data silos are dead

The Financial Finale: Finally, the Billing and Accounting module compiles every service—consultation, lab tests, and room charges—into one transparent invoice. Role-Based Access: Admins can set specific permissions for doctors, nurses, accountants, and receptionists.

Live Consultations: This version supports Zoom integration, allowing for remote telehealth appointments directly within the system.
